A firefox-esr security update has been released for Debian GNU/Linux 10 and 11 to address multiple security issues.



DSA 5044-1: firefox-esr security update

Package : firefox-esr
CVE ID : CVE-2021-4140 CVE-2022-22737 CVE-2022-22738 CVE-2022-22739
CVE-2022-22740 CVE-2022-22741 CVE-2022-22742 CVE-2022-22743
CVE-2022-22745 CVE-2022-22747 CVE-2022-22748 CVE-2022-22751

Multiple security issues have been found in the Mozilla Firefox web
browser, which could potentially result in the execution of arbitrary code,
information disclosure, denial of service or spoofing.

For the oldstable distribution (buster), these problems have been fixed
in version 91.5.0esr-1~deb10u1. Not all architectures are available for
oldstable yet, most notably i386 (32 bits x86) is missing.

For the stable distribution (bullseye), these problems have been fixed in
version 91.5.0esr-1~deb11u1.

We recommend that you upgrade your firefox-esr packages.
